Heim > Backend-Entwicklung > C#.Net-Tutorial > Was bedeutet ×= in der C-Sprache?

Was bedeutet ×= in der C-Sprache?

下次还敢
Freigeben: 2024-05-02 18:57:43
Original
370 Leute haben es durchsucht

Der Operator ×= in der Sprache C wird verwendet, um eine Variable mit einem bestimmten Wert zu multiplizieren und das Ergebnis wieder in der Variablen selbst zu speichern. Zu seinen Vorteilen gehört die Verbesserung der Codeeffizienz. Die spezifische Syntax lautet Variable = Wert;. Diese Operation entspricht Variable = Variablenwert;, ist jedoch prägnanter und effizienter. 🎘 Variable selbst.

Syntax: Was bedeutet ×= in der C-Sprache?

<code class="c">variable *= value;</code>
Nach dem Login kopieren

So funktioniert es:

Zuerst wird Wert

mit dem aktuellen Wert der Variablen

Variable multipliziert.

Dann speichern Sie das Produktergebnis wieder in der

Variable.

  • Beispiel: Angenommen, wir haben eine Variable x
  • mit einem Wert von 10. Nach der Ausführung des folgenden Codes:
  • <code class="c">x *= 2;</code>
    Nach dem Login kopieren
    wird der Wert von x
  • zu 20. Das liegt daran: Der aktuelle Wert von

x

ist 10.

Multiplizieren Sie 10 mal 2, um 20 zu erhalten.

20 wird wieder auf

x gespeichert.

  • Vorteile:
  • Die Verwendung des ×=-Operators ist schneller als die Ausführung der entsprechenden Zuweisungsoperation, da Zuweisung und Multiplikation in einem einzigen Schritt kombiniert werden. Dies kann Ihren Code effizienter machen, insbesondere wenn Sie viele Multiplikationsoperationen durchführen müssen.
  • Hinweis:
  • ×=-Operator gilt nur für numerische Variablen. Es kann nicht mit Zeichen oder anderen Variablentypen verwendet werden.

Das obige ist der detaillierte Inhalt vonWas bedeutet ×= in der C-Sprache?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Verwandte Etiketten:
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age